Why Agriculture Businesses Need a Website

The agriculture industry has traditionally relied on word-of-mouth, local markets, and wholesale contracts. While these channels still matter, digital discovery is now a primary driver of business for farms, agri-suppliers, cooperatives, and rural service providers.

Reaching customers beyond your region

A website extends your reach far beyond your local community. Buyers, distributors, and retailers searching for specialty crops, certified organic produce, or sustainable farming equipment can find you instantly through search engines. This dramatically expands your potential market without adding significant overhead.

Building trust and credibility

Consumers are now requesting to know the source of their food. A quality website will allow you to tell your farm’s history, provide information about its certifications, describe your farming methods, and display who is involved with running your farm. The transparency demonstrated by your website will create strong relationships of trust with these health-conscious and environmentally aware customers who will pay extra for products from brands that they believe are trustworthy.

Enabling direct sales and bookings

With an e-commerce-enabled agriculture site, you can sell directly to customers and cut out the middleman, giving you a much better profit margin than if you were selling through another outlet. You will also be able to accept reservations for agritourism, farm tours, community supported agriculture (CSA) subscriptions, and seasonal harvest events without making a phone call to anyone.

Planning Your Agriculture Website

Rushing into design without a clear plan is the most common mistake new website owners make. A thoughtful planning phase saves time, money, and frustration later.

Define your goals and audience

Consider your purpose for creating the website! Some possible objectives for creating your website would be increasing the amount of direct sales from produce, gaining more wholesale customers, marketing agritourism, promoting education, or hiring farm help. The audience you are trying to reach will drive your decisions related to the content, tone, and design of your website.

Choose the right domain name

Your domain name is your digital address. It should be short, easy to spell, and relevant to your farm or agricultural business. Ideally, include a keyword like “farm,” “organic,” “agri,” or your farm’s name. Domains ending in .com remain the most trusted, though .farm and .ag extensions are growing in popularity among niche audiences.

Choosing the Right Platform for Your Agriculture Website

The platform you build on shapes everything flexibility, cost, maintenance, and scalability.

WordPress with WooCommerce

WordPress powers over 43% of all websites worldwide and remains the top choice for agriculture businesses. Paired with WooCommerce, it delivers a fully customizable e-commerce experience. Thousands of agriculture-specific themes and plugins are available, covering everything from crop management displays to CSA subscription boxes.

Shopify for direct-to-consumer farms

If your primary goal is selling products online, Shopify offers a streamlined, beginner-friendly experience. It handles payments, inventory, shipping, and taxes with minimal technical effort. Many farm-to-table businesses and specialty food producers use Shopify for its reliable checkout and growing suite of marketing tools.

Custom-built solutions

Large agribusinesses, cooperatives, and agricultural service providers with complex needs may require a fully custom-built website developed by professional web developers. Custom solutions offer maximum flexibility but come with higher costs and longer development timelines.

Launching and Maintaining Your Agriculture Website

Launching is just the beginning. A website that sits unchanged for years loses relevance in search rankings and with returning visitors.

Pre-launch checklist

Before going live, verify that all pages load correctly on mobile and desktop, all links work, contact forms send successfully, your SSL certificate is active (https://), product checkout functions flawlessly, and your site speed scores well on Google PageSpeed Insights.

Ongoing content and maintenance

Post new content at least twice per month. Update product listings to reflect current availability. Perform regular security updates and backups. Review your Google Analytics data monthly to understand which pages attract the most visitors and which products generate the most interest, then optimize accordingly.
